Kit purpose

This quad-channel kit provides 32 GB of DDR4 memory across four 8 GB modules. It targets desktop builders who want matched sticks for AMD X399, TRX40, X570, X470 or B550 platforms and Intel X299, Z790 DDR4, Z690 DDR4, Z590 or Z490 platforms. The RGB light bar adds visual customisation without extra cables.

Deciding spec

The kit runs at DDR4 3200 with a CAS latency of 16 and timings of 16-18-18-38 at 1.35 V. Intel XMP 2.0 loads those settings automatically. Mixing this kit with other modules is not supported because the sticks are validated as a matched set.

Thermals and power

Aluminium heatspreaders with a fin array dissipate heat from the ICs during sustained loads. The modules draw 1.35 V, a standard DDR4 voltage that keeps power draw modest. No active cooling is required and the kit operates silently.

Questions about this item

What does DDR4 3200 CL16 mean for actual system performance?

The kit runs at 3200 MT/s with 16-18-18-38 timings at 1.35 V, so the memory controller sees a 3200 MT/s data rate and 16-cycle CAS latency once XMP 2.0 is enabled in BIOS.

How does the 288-pin DDR4 interface limit the usable speed on my motherboard?

The 288-pin DDR4 modules operate at 3200 MT/s (PC4-25600) when the board's memory controller and BIOS support that data rate; the DDR4 standard itself caps at the JEDEC-defined speeds the platform allows.

What clearance do the Trident Z RGB heatspreaders need above the DIMM slots?

Each module uses an aluminum heatspreader with an exposed RGB light bar on top, so the cooler or chassis must provide enough vertical room for the full finned height above the 288-pin connector.
